Emerging Technological Trends Shaping the Industry

Artificial Intelligence, blockchain integration, and behavioural analytics are at the forefront of innovation. These technologies facilitate personalization, enhance security, and provide better oversight of gambling activities. For example, AI-driven algorithms now enable real-time monitoring of player behaviour, allowing operators to identify early signs of problematic gambling patterns.

An industry report by IGT notes that platforms embracing responsible gaming features have seen a 23% reduction in gaming-related harm incidents over two years, underscoring the importance of technology in safeguarding players.

Responsible Gaming as a Cornerstone of Modern Platforms

In a landscape saturated with options, responsible gaming tools are no longer optional but essential. This includes self-exclusion modules, deposit limits, and real-time alerts. The industry recognises that fostering trust and sustainability depends on transparent, user-centric safety measures.

Moreover, some platforms leverage blockchain to enhance transparency, providing verifiable audit trails for game fairness—further reinforcing credibility with informed players.
